Cash Flow Projection | Advantages, Steps, & More

A cash flow projection estimates the money you expect to flow in and out of your business, including all of your income and expenses. Typically, most businesses' cash flow projections cover a 12-month period. However, your business can create a weekly, monthly, or semi-annual cash flow projection. How to Prepare Cash Flow Projection for Small Business

Cash flow projection is an estimate of the cash flows into the business through revenue and borrowings and the expected cash outflow through purchases, expenses and repayments. Small Business Administration

Cash from Loans Received and Owners' Injections go in the "Loan/ other cash inj." row. The "Pre-Startup" column is for cash outlays prior to the time covered by the Cash Flow. It is intended primarily for new business startups or major expansion projects where a great deal of cash must go out before operations commence.

Creating a Cash Flow Projection - Wells Fargo

With these realistic assumptions in hand, you can begin drafting your cash flow projection. To get started, create 12 columns across the top of a spreadsheet, representing the next 12 months. Then, on the left-hand side, list the following cash flow categories: Operating cash, beginning — The amount of money you'll have at the beginning of ...
